Fletcher announced that every nibble must be eaten at a rate of 100 times a min and swallowed just after it was liquefied and devoid of taste. This protected against"rank decay" in the stomach and provided feces say goodbye to fragrant than a warm biscuit. He lugged examples of his own waste matter to confirm that point. Rockefeller, Thomas Edison and Franz Kafka. Socialites held Fletcher luncheons, where they timed their chews with stopwatches. One united state senator suggested that all American schoolchildren be taught Fletcherism. The Great Masticator had adequate off-the-wall competition in the 19th century. While dealing with Civil.

War soldiers on combat zones, J.H. Salisbury, M.D., claimed to have found that a meat-only diet regimen was the key to a long, healthy and balanced life. The very firstdish of the day needed to be all vegetables. The 2nd all fruit. The third all nuts. And New york city doctor William Hay, M.D., urged that the only way to stay slim was never ever to eat protein and carbohydrates in the very same meal. In the 1920s, the Hollywood Diet regimen swept the country, as actors slimmed down by eating grapefruit and.

not much else. Other schemes were downright harmful. Fortunate Strike cigarette marketers encouraged women customers to "grab a Lucky as opposed to a wonderful. "In his 1960s bestseller The Drinking Man's Diet, cosmetics executive Robert Cameron pitched basically unrestricted quantities of liquor and fatty meat. My daddy went on Cameron's diet. He did lose some weight, but his initial cardiovascular disease came a few years later. In the mid-1800s, Sylvester Graham, a Presbyterian priest(of graham cracker fame), preached the scripture of eating a bland, meatless diet regimen heavy on entire grains and unleavened bread. It had actually the added benefit, he claimed, of reducing libido and stopping masturbation. These suspicious advantages aside, Graham's ideas proclaimed modern-day vegan, vegetarian and low-fat diet regimens, such as those from the American Heart Organization , Dean Ornish, M.D., and Pritikin. I cleaned. I became a vegetarian, then a vegan. I signed up with WW. I went gluten-free. I attempted Ornish's extremely low-fat, meat-free diet plan, as well as meat-is-just-fine plans like South Beach, Atkins and paleo. However whatever course I took, the results were the same. I slimmed down only to plump back up. Frank Sacks, M.D., a professor of heart disease prevention at the Harvard College of Public Health And Wellness, who has actually published over 220 initial research study articles and practically 90 evaluations, editorials and letters, discovered that, ultimately, the kind of diet regimen doesn't matter. People shed and reclaim the same amount of weightand in some cases a lot more despite which program they choose.

When I had just about wrapped up that a lot of weight-loss strategies were futileat the very least for meI found that somehow thousands of Americans have actually done well. The records of their achievements are kept by the National Weight Control Pc Registry, whose 12,000-plus enrollees have shed a minimum of 30 pounds and maintained the weight off for approximately 6 years.

-1

Graham Thomas, Ph. D., an associate professor of psychiatry and human habits at Brown College, has been researching participants to figure out just how they did it. The trick is that there is no key. Some consumed low-fat, some ate low-carb and some ate usually. Fifty percent took part in arranged weight-loss programs, half did it on their very own.

In the past, behavior methods were used as stand-alone treatments to just customize eating behaviors and lower caloric intake. Nevertheless, much more recently, these therapies have been utilized in mix with low-calorie diet plans, clinical nourishment treatment, nutrition education and learning, workout programs, surveillance, pharmacological agents, and social support to advertise weight management, and as a component of maintenance programs.

Self-monitoring of food consumption is frequently connected with a relatively immediate decrease in food intake and following weight reduction (Blundell, 2000; Goris et al., 2000). This decrease in food intake is believed to arise from boosted understanding of food consumption and/or issue concerning what the dietitian or nutrition specialist will think concerning the person's eating habits.

-1

The exact same may be true of exercise monitoring, although little research study has been carried out in this field. Self-monitoring likewise offers a means for specialists and individuals to evaluate which techniques are functioning and how modifications in eating behavior or task are adding to fat burning. Recent job has actually recommended that routine self-monitoring of body weight is a helpful complement to therapy programs (Jeffery and French, 1999).

In their evaluation of data from the National Weight Control Windows Registry, Klem and coworkers (1997) found that weight loss attained through workout, sensible dieting, minimized fat usage, and private habits adjustments could be preserved for extended periods of time. This populace was self-selected so it does not represent the experience of the ordinary individual in a noncombatant populace.
